Time For Yourself
Description
If you’re like most parents and caregivers, you spend lots of time focused on the needs of others and tend to neglect your own needs. How long can you go on like this? Who is going to meet your needs if you don’t? In this session, we dig into the importance of investing in self-care.
Learning Goals
Attendees will:
- Learn the importance of investing time and energy in self-care
- Learn strategies for making more time for their own needs
- Understand that investing in self-care makes them better at taking care of others
